First off – horizontal or vertical, our new monitors are engineered to be ultra-slim and lightweight. The absence of bulky casing gives them a slick look that is ideal for outdoor menu boards and kiosks.

But don’t let ‘light and slim’ fool you because there is zero compromise in strength and reliability, and all our monitors exceed IP65-rated protection. This means that they are waterproof and weatherproof against sun, rain, snow and wind. Their advanced sealing also keeps dust out, so you only need to clean the exterior shell, minimizing maintenance.

Technical Specifications
Sizes 32”, 43”, 49”, 55”, 65”, 75”, 86”
Temperature Tolerance LCD area operates from -30°C to 90°C
UV Isolation 94% efficiency
Infrared Insulation Reduces heat buildup by 45%

But a great display is nothing without great visibility and this is where our new monitors truly deliver – even under direct sunlight. 4000 nits of brightness and IPS technology delivers clear images from nearly any angle, even though these are ultra-low power displays.

Of course, these displays aren’t exclusively for commercial environments. They are flexible and robust enough for industrial use, with a truly impressive temperature tolerance.
